@Anonymous wrote:Amex Blue was instanlty approved and for Everyday got this msg. I don't feel like calling them in. I am going on a vacation, I don't have the time to call them. Will they still process the application if I don't call them in?
" In order to provide you with an instant decision, we need to speak with you. We are available to assist you during our Hours of Operations: Monday-Friday 8AM to Midnight, Saturdays 9:30AM to 9PM, and Sundays 10AM to 9PM Eastern Time."
If you applied for both in a very short time, it could be their "Fraud Prevention" mechanism. They want to make sure it was YOU that applied for both. The process is relatively quick and painless. SImply answer some questions, and you'll get a decision. The same process happened to me - Approved for the SkyMiles Card and then EveryDay card I got (they need to speak with me). Spoke with them for 2 minutes and it was approved.
